In the ninety years since the Chattanooga Bakery began producing MoonPies, the snack grew from a regional treat, to a worldwide phenomenon. Filled with anecdotes by aficionados from across the South, this work presents a story of what began as a portable food for Kentucky and Tennessee coal miners and became a favorite product of Sam Walton.
